We are Nacro. We see your future, whatever the past.

We believe that everyone deserves a good education, a safe and secure place to live, the right to be heard, and the chance to start again, with support from someone on their side.

That’s why our housing, education, justice and health and wellbeing services work alongside people to give them the support and skills they need to succeed. And it’s why we fight for their voices to be heard and campaign together to create lasting change.

What will I be doing as a teacher at Nacro?

As a key member of the teaching team, your main focus will always be teaching, learning, and assessment, supporting students to make appropriate progress in lessons, resulting in them achieving qualifications. You will also play an important role within the centre community, supporting your students pastorally, and will have duties related to assurance, making sure our courses run on time, and to a high standard.

Duties include (but are not limited to):

·Preparing for learning by planning lessons, developing resources, and caring for our classroom spaces,

·Monitoring students’ progress on their course, providing feedback and support so that students can improve,

·Assessing students and their work so that they achieve as expected and as needed for their next steps,

·Working with your colleagues to enhance delivery, identify support needs, and contributing to student experience and enrichment,

·You may be asked to deliver tutorial or skills lessons as part of your role using our ready-made lessons resources.

Requirements for this role:

·English and Maths at GCSE grade C/4 or above is essential,

·All candidates will require an enhanced DBS check,

·A teaching qualification is desirable but not essential, Nacro is proud to support those new to teaching.
